Escape the Room offers one generic hint for free, but makes you pay for further contextual hints -- $3 for all hints for a scenario with a $0.50 discount for Prime members (the clue price converts to roughly £2 and AU$4). The developers just launched a new scenario -- Escape the Airplane -- for a total of five scenarios after launching with three, so hopefully they keep adding more.

Escape The Room on Alexa presented 4 straightforward escape room scenarios: The Office; The Car; The Jail Cell; The Garage; In each scenario, for reasons unknown, we were locked in the location and had to escape. It was rigidly structured. Some of the phrasing you need to use isn't intuitive and you need to be very careful with your language when you give a command. For example, if Alexa reads off a long clue or goes over a series of objects, you can't just say "repeat that." In the game, you can look up, down, forward, left or right.
